The Physiological Link Between Low Iron and Sugar Cravings
Iron is an essential mineral vital for numerous bodily functions, most notably the production of hemoglobin. Hemoglobin is a protein in red blood cells responsible for carrying oxygen from the lungs to every cell in the body. When iron levels are insufficient, the body cannot produce enough healthy red blood cells, a condition known as iron deficiency anemia (IDA). This leads to a cascade of effects that can drive sugar cravings.
Why Fatigue Triggers a Sweet Tooth
One of the most common symptoms of low iron is overwhelming fatigue and weakness. Without enough oxygen being delivered to the body's tissues and muscles, cellular energy production becomes less efficient. In response to this energy deficit, the body seeks the quickest form of fuel available: sugar. Sugary foods provide a rapid, albeit temporary, spike in blood glucose, giving a false sense of renewed energy. This creates a vicious cycle where a person experiences a short-lived sugar rush followed by an inevitable crash, prompting another craving for sweets to regain the energy lost.

Low Iron, Blood Sugar, and Insulin
Research is exploring the connection between iron status and glucose metabolism. Some studies suggest that iron deficiency may disrupt glucose homeostasis and insulin signaling. Animal studies have shown that moderate iron deficiency can impair glucose regulation. While the exact mechanisms are still being studied, iron's role in energy production may be important. These disruptions could contribute to low energy feelings and sugar cravings.

Strategies for Managing Sugar Cravings with Low Iron
Addressing the root cause of the cravings is key. The following strategies can help you manage your sugar cravings while working to correct your iron levels:
- Prioritize Iron-Rich Foods: Increase your intake of heme iron from animal sources like red meat, poultry, and seafood, which is more easily absorbed by the body. For non-heme iron from plant sources, such as lentils, beans, tofu, and leafy greens, consume them alongside vitamin C to boost absorption.
- Enhance Iron Absorption: Drink orange juice with your iron-fortified breakfast cereal, or add strawberries and bell peppers to a spinach salad. Avoid consuming calcium-rich foods, coffee, or tea at the same time as your iron-rich meals, as they can inhibit absorption.
- Focus on Balanced Meals: Pair complex carbohydrates (like brown rice and whole grains) with protein and healthy fats to stabilize blood sugar levels. This prevents the drastic spikes and crashes that trigger sugar cravings.

The Role of Medical Intervention
While dietary changes are crucial, they may not be sufficient for individuals with significant iron deficiency. In such cases, a healthcare provider may recommend iron supplements. It is important to consult a doctor before starting any supplementation, as excessive iron intake can be harmful. Regular blood tests can help monitor iron levels and track progress.
